G.8132 Overview Presentation for the T-MPLS JWT Igor Umansky ITU-T SG15 Plenary Meeting, February 2008, Geneva Network objectives The following objectives shall be met: The T-MPLS Section layer protects against any failure that is detected by the T-MPLS section OAM. Protected entities: p-t-p and p-t-mp T-MPLS connections. Switch time: the completion time for protection against a single failure shall be less than 50 ms assuming a reference network with a 16 nodes ring of and less than 1200 km of fibre and no hold-off timer. Traffic types Normal traffic: this type of traffic must be protected against any single failure. Non-preemptable unprotected traffic: this type of traffic is not protected by the ring protection scheme. Network objectives (cont.) Hold-off time: to avoid protection switching cascade in different network layers when a lower layer network protection mechanism is activated in conjunction with the T-MPLS layer protection scheme. Usage of hold-off timers allows the lower layer to restore working traffic before the T-MPLS layer initiates a protection action. Wait to-restore time: to avoid flapping of the protection switching in case of unstable network failure conditions. Extent of protection For a single failure, the ring will restore all normal traffic that would be passing through the failed location. The ring should restore all normal traffic, if possible, under multiple failure conditions. Network objectives (cont.) APS protocol and algorithm The switching protocol shall be able to accommodate as a minimum up to 127 nodes on a ring. The APS protocol and associated OAM functions shall accommodate the capability to upgrade the ring (node insertion / removal), limiting the possible impact on existing traffic on the ring. All spans on a ring shall have equal priority in case of multiple failures.
